Average Time for a 5k & what affects it
Many runners wonder what the average time for a 5k really is. It depends on your age, gender, and experience. Most beginners finish in about 30 to 35 minutes, while trained runners often come in closer to 22 to 28 minutes. Elite runners can complete a 5K in under 17 minutes on a flat course.

Average 5K Times by Experience
These are typical finish ranges across ability levels:
- Beginners: 30–40 minutes (6–8 minutes per km)
- Intermediate runners: 22–30 minutes (4:30–6 minutes per km)
- Advanced runners: 18–22 minutes (3:30–4:30 minutes per km)
- Elite athletes: 15–17 minutes for men, 16–19 for women
How Age and Gender Influence 5K Times
Race statistics show the average 5K time for men is around 28 minutes, while women average closer to 33 minutes. Runners in their 30s often hit their peak pace, but steady training keeps performance strong well into later decades.

Training to Improve Your Average Time
Improving your 5K is about variety. Mix short interval runs for speed, tempo runs for control, and long easy runs for endurance. Two short strength sessions weekly help build power and reduce injury risk.
Pacing Tips for Race Day
Start controlled for the first kilometre, hold an even pace through the middle, and finish with effort in the final stretch. Even pacing nearly always beats an all-out start.
